How is it possible to make a better Technical ski than Atomic’s Redster X9? It has the stability of a sumo wrestler and the reflexes of a fencer. If there’s a speed at which the edge breaks loose, chances are you’ll never touch it. Its imperturbable hold is amplified by a feature called Servotec, a long, thin rod embedded in an elastomer under the binding at one end and attached on the other end at a point just behind the shovel. The interaction of the rod and the elastomer during flexion both absorbs shock and actively restores ski/snow contact.
Cloud 12
There isn’t an ounce of condescension in Atomic’s Cloud 12. Of course it doesn’t meet FIS specs, but that’s the whole point of the Technical category, to apply race room production to more versatile shapes. The Cloud 12 isn’t made for the lackadaisical carver who wants to hang out on the tail end of a turn long enough to check her messages. The second self-evident feature that helps define the Cloud 12’s behavior is its svelte shape. This streamlined rocket thinks of recreational runs as another opportunity to win something, taking off down the fall line as if suddenly freed from a bad relationship.
Intense 12
Powerdrive is Dynastar’s name for a 3-piece sidewall which functions as a unique damping system. Stacked on edge alongside the core, it consists of a soft inner layer, a hard center section and a dynamic outer wall. Any time a viscoelastic material, like that used in the inner piece of Powerdrive, is bonded to Titanal (center part), the resulting element will act as a natural shock absorber, so the forebody of the Intense 12, where the Powerdrive feature resides, should stay nice and quiet on hard snow.
